Trimmed version of Brahmotsavam from today

Published on Saturday, 21 May 2016 02:46 PM


Mahesh Babu’s Brahmotsavam released to packed houses all over. But the one complaint which everyone had was of the excessive length. Taking evasive action, the makers have now trimmed of close to 17 minutes from the runtime.

The Nasser episode and the song ‘Put your hands up’ have been chopped off from the second half. Directed by Srikanth Addala, Brahmotsavam has music by Mickey J Meyer which has been appreciated big time.

PVP Cinema in association with Mahesh Babu has produced this film.
